When you upgrade to Windows 7, you keep your files, settings, and programs from your
current version of Windows.
1. Turn on your computer so that Windows starts normally. (To perform an upgrade, you cannot start, or "boot," your computer from the Windows 7 upgrade disc. )
2. Insert the Windows installation disc into your computer's DVD or CD drive.
3. On the Install Windows page, click Install now.
4. On the Get important updates for installation page, we recommend getting the latest updates to help ensure a successful installation and to help protect your computer against security threats. You need an Internet connection to get installation updates.
5. On the Please read the license terms page, if you accept the license terms, click I accept the license terms.
6. On the Which type of installation do you want? page, click Upgrade to begin the upgrade. You might see a
compatibility report.
7. Follow the instructions.
